Taxon: Huperzia lucidula (Michaux) Trevisan
Family: Lycopodiaceae
Collector: Anderson, Chel E.   2430   
Date: 2017-07-20
Verbatim Date: 20-Jul-2017
Locality: United States, Minnesota, Koochiching, 4.3 miles NE of Big Falls on Hwy 71. About .6 mi SE into lowland forest and peatland complex.
48.24  -93.74
Verbatim Coordinates: T066N R26W sec06
Habitat: Locally abundant in dense shade of white cedar. Growing on raised tree bases, roots and coarse woody debris.
Associated Species: Assoc. Gymnocarpium dryopteris, Viola sp., Maianthemum trifolia, Coptis trifolia, Mitella nuda, Osmundastrum cinnamomeum, Lonicera canadensis, Dryopteris carthusiana.
